1952), The performance was such that that the National Coal Board adopted the
Austerity as its standard design and Hunslets continued to build them for the
Board and others until 1964. By the time the final order was completed a total
of 484 Austerities had been built over 22 years. Some of the war-time
locomotives were also rebuilt, mainly for the NCB, and given new works numbers.
